Game: Cleveland at Detroit (8:00 PM Eastern) Pick: 3 units on Cleveland +5.5
Are we witnessing the changing of the guard in the Eastern Conference Finals, or will Detroit rebound and take charge of this series once again? We watched this Cleveland team fall back 2-0 last year, then come back to take a 3-2 lead only to lose the opportunity in game 6 at home by two points, and was easily put away in game 7 back in Detroit. Last year Cleveland had a lot of scrap and fight, but didn't have the experience to find a way to make it work. They covered less than 40% of their road games vs. playoff teams on the road. This season, things looked to be taking the same path, as they started 1-8 ATS on the road against playoff teams, but began to gel as a team and have finished an amazing 16-2 ATS against playoff teams, including 5 of 6 in the playoffs and have suffered just one loss by more than five points! This team has grown up, and winning in the playoffs is about winning on the road and finishing the job at home. Detroit was an above .500 team at home last year ATS against playoff-bound teams and over .500 in the playoffs as well. This year they have stumbled on both counts, 9-16-1 ATS during the regular season and now just 3-4 in the playoffs. The fact is that Cleveland should have already won this series 4-0, and have out-played Detroit all series because, quite frankly, they have become the better team and their maturity has shown itself since mid-season. Look for the Cavs to at the very least stay close, and if they win, they close out Detroit in 6 back in Cleveland.
